In practical application, expert builders emphasize the importance of proper installation to maximize the flange's effectiveness. The flange is typically screwed directly into wooden or concrete floors using appropriate fasteners, ensuring a snug fit. Experts advise ensuring that the flange is flat and level before securing tightly, as even minor deviations can lead to system failures or leaks. Additionally, leveraging washers and thread sealants can further bolster the flange's sealing capacity, enhancing the trustworthiness of the system over time.
